B I O G R A P H Y

With eight number one singles, six more top 10 hits, an ASCAP Award, and two Dove Award nominations, Greg Long embarks on a new leg of his acclaimed journey with passion and excitement.  Not only has his long-awaited Christian Records debut, "Born Again", released, but Greg has officially joined Sparrow Records’ multi-Dove Award-winning, American Music Award-winning platinum selling group, Avalon.   While it may sound like a full plate, Greg is enjoying the ride as he continues to grow his relationship with God and expand his career and ministry...

W H O  H E  I S...
Greg Long's smooth, tenor voice was heard on radio on the early 90s with his first hit song "How Long".  Until 2004 Greg had other hits like "Jesus Saves", "In the Waiting", "Born Again", "Sufficiency of Grace" and "Mercy Said No".  But his career didn't end - Greg joined wife Janna in the hit foursome Avalon.  And now his voice has been heard on Avalon hits like "I Wanna Be With You" and "Love Won't Leave You".
